github " />
GitHub是全球最大的开源软件开发平台,这个平台给开发者提供了一个公共的版本管理仓库,然而,有时,由于安全和隐私,公司或大型開发項目需要部署自己的本地版GitHub。本文将讨论GitHub本地部署的费用和如何在本地仓库与GitHub互相同步。
1. GitHub本地部署费用
GitHub在2015年发布了GitHub Enterprise,这是一款GitHub本地版本。它提供了与在云上的GitHub.com相同的功能,但可以部署在公司的私有内部网络中,并提供更高级别的安全保护措施。不过,需要注意的是,GitHub Enterprise在维护和升级方面也需要一定程度的技术支持,因此只有资深的技术人员才能部署和管理它们。此外,GitHub Enterprise也需要许可证费用,具体价格取决于企业的规模和需求,价格范围从3,000美元/年起。
2. 本地仓库同步GitHub
GitHub的本地部署版本在操作上与GitHub.com非常相似。在部署系统之后,可以使用Git命令从GitHub.com克隆您的存储库。 克隆后,可以使用标准的Git命令本地添加/编辑/删除文件和提交更改。然后将更改推送回GitHub.com,以便其他开发人员可以看到您的更改。
另外,还有一种方式是通过GitHub Webhooks来实现本地仓库自动同步GitHub.com的能力。 您可以使用Webhooks来获取来自GitHub.com的实时事件,例如共享资源的新版本或pull request的开放。使用Webhooks,可以将GitHub上的事件触发器连接到您的本地存储库中的操作。例如,可以使用Webhooks在某个开发人员提交代码时,将代码自动更新到您的本地存储库中。
综上所述,GitHub本地部署的费用主要取决于公司需求和规模,而通过Webhooks等方式实现本地仓库与GitHub.com同步的能力,也可以极大地提高开发效率和安全性。
壹涵网络我们是一家专注于网站建设、企业营销、网站关键词排名、AI内容生成、新媒体营销和短视频营销等业务的公司。我们拥有一支优秀的团队,专门致力于为客户提供优质的服务。
我们致力于为客户提供一站式的互联网营销服务,帮助客户在激烈的市场竞争中获得更大的优势和发展机会!
发表评论 取消回复